SAIC is seeking a Space Systems Engineer to join the National Security and Space Sector (NSS). You would work on a joint Intelligence Community (IC) and Department of Defense (DoD) crown jewel program providing highly specialized space/counter-space engineering, scientific, and analytical services from Aurora, Colorado. We support the Nation's leading edge IC and DoD space programs and offer compelling, deep-technical work that has direct influence and impact on program development and operations. Our team has Subject Matter Experts (SMEs) across a variety of disciplines, including physics, math, RF, optics, space acquisition and operations, and intelligence collection and analysis. Expected salary is $160 to $200k.

This Space Systems Engineer will work in a collaborative team-focused environment of U.S. Government civilians and contractors solving applied technical problems and developing usable solutions for multiple space-related capabilities and threats. The ideal candidate will:
  • Have the ability to conceptualize, synthesize, analyze, and assess space systems, applications, and effects, including characteristics, performance, concepts of operations (CONOPS), and system, component, and material susceptibilities.
  • Knowledge and experience with space systems engineering, operations, space threats and protection in one or more domains (RF, optical, radar).
  • Be motivated by problem solving and creating a range of potential solutions, over actual system or component development.
  • Have experience with IC and/or DoD satellite systems in Sensitive Compartmented Information (SCI) or Special Access Program (SAP) environments.


Duties and responsibilities include:
  • Contributing to capability and CONOPs development and recommendations for emerging space applications, ranging from architectures to payload operations in RF, optical and radar domains.
  • Developing and maintaining in-depth knowledge of U.S. national security space capabilities, foreign space capabilities, and counter-space threats.
  • Supporting the development and execution of multi-domain Space Object and Identification (SOSI) collections and participating in the data analysis function.
  • Participating in modeling, simulation and orbit analyses, and conducting technical trades.
  • Identifying gaps and prioritizing recommendations to achieve program protection objectives.
  • Participating and representing the customer in various Government and contractor meetings and attend contractor programmatic and technical reviews (e.g. PMR, PDR, CDR, etc.) to provide technical recommendations and risk assessments.
  • Frequently interacting with program managers, SETAs, FFRDCs and external stakeholders.
  • Developing productive relationships with the Program Office, Prime, and Subcontract counterparts, functional IC or DoD counterparts, and other SMEs.

Qualifications

Required Skills:
  • Minimum of a Bachelor's Degree in Physics, Engineering or Math and 14 or more years (12 or more with a Masters) of direct experience with satellite systems in one or more domains (RF, radar, optical).
  • Active TS/SCI Clearance with Polygraph.
  • U.S. Citizenship is required.
  • Proven experience in core systems engineering and analysis disciplines and processes.
  • Experience in one or more fields of modelling space system signatures (RF, radar, or optical).
  • Ability to work effectively in team-based environment including critical review of work products, as well as the individual environment with limited direction on how to accomplish assigned tasks.
  • Strong communication skills (technical writing, presentation development, team and customer interactions, etc.).
  • Demonstrated problem solving and critical thinking in complex and dynamic organizational environments.
  • Demonstrated willingness to be flexible and adaptable to changing priorities and make objective, defendable work products with the information at hand.

Strongly Desired Skills:
  • Master's Degree in Physics, Engineering, or Mathematics.
  • Familiarity with RF hardware systems including satellite communication systems and threats.
  • Hands-on experience with creating models, algorithms and engineering tools for modeling RF, radar or optical signatures of space systems.
  • Working knowledge of space tracking radars, RF payload operations, and/or optical SDA technologies.
  • Familiarity with National Security Space architecture (IC and/or DoD).
  • Understanding and familiarity with satellite orbitology and orbit analysis tools such as STK.
  • Experience developing code and tools in support of analysis objectives (Python, MATLAB, Linux, COAST/FIST, or similar).
  • Overhead IMINT and/or SIGINT and geolocation experience.
  • Experience as a project or task technical lead.
